Following the devastating floods in eastern Kentucky in 2022, NOMI was commissioned in 2023 to design the renovation of the Hindman School of Craft. This building holds deep historical and cultural significance. It currently serves as the home of the Troublesome Creek Stringed Instrument Company, a notable nonprofit that runs a recovery program where participants are trained to become luthiers. Originally constructed in 1931 as part of the Works Progress Administration (WPA), the building stands out for its distinctive architecture. As noted in the National Register of Historic Places Nomination, “Of all the WPA buildings built in the county in the 1930s, this is the most ambitious and out-of-place. It was the largest educational facility constructed in the county before the mid-1970s and features three tunneled archways leading into a central courtyard, which is enclosed by classrooms and stone-columned covered walkways.”
